Parking Lot Gravel Repair in Katy, TX
Parking lot gravel repair services involve restoring and maintaining the gravel surfaces of driveways, parking areas, and other paved zones on residential properties. This service typically includes filling in holes, leveling uneven sections, and replacing or adding gravel to ensure a smooth, stable surface. Projects may range from small patches to larger areas that require comprehensive grading and gravel replenishment, helping property owners keep their parking areas safe and functional.
Homeowners interested in gravel repair usually want to understand the scope of work needed to address issues like ruts, erosion, or loose gravel that can develop over time. It’s important to consider factors such as the extent of damage, the type of gravel used, and the ongoing maintenance required to keep the surface in good condition. Common Parking Lot Gravel Repair Jobs
Gravel pothole repair - filling and leveling sunken or damaged areas to restore surface smoothness.
Crack sealing - sealing cracks to prevent water infiltration and further deterioration.
Surface leveling - addressing uneven spots for safer and more stable parking areas.
Drainage correction - improving gravel drainage to reduce erosion and maintain structural integrity.
Regrading services - reshaping the lot surface for better runoff and a more even appearance.
Edge stabilization - reinforcing gravel edges to prevent spreading and maintain lot boundaries.
Parking Lot Gravel Repair Questions
What causes gravel parking lots to need repair? Common causes include erosion, vehicle traffic, and weather conditions that loosen or displace gravel over time.
What types of repairs are available for gravel parking lots? Repairs typically involve adding or replacing gravel, leveling uneven areas, and addressing drainage issues to prevent further damage.
How can gravel parking lot damage be prevented? Proper maintenance, such as regular grading and ensuring good drainage, helps reduce the risk of damage and extends the lifespan of the lot.
What signs indicate a gravel parking lot needs repair? Signs include uneven surfaces, potholes, loose gravel, and areas where gravel has washed away or shifted significantly.
